Speeds monitored

Traffic speeds have been monitored by Gosford Council along Brick Wharf Rd, Woy Woy.

A survey of traffic speed was recently carried out between the two traffic calming devices on the road, with average speeds recorded between 57km/h eastbound and 58km/h westbound.

A member of Gosford Council's Traffic Committee had asked council to monitor the effectiveness of traffic calming devices on Brick Wharf Rd, at its meeting of August 6.

Council has resolved that the reports of excessive traffic speed on Brick Wharf Rd be brought to the attention of the NSW Police Force for consideration of "enhanced enforcement where practicable".
